    Interesting - for some reason (wrong!!) I thought the 20% discount would come off the total at the end - ie. $69.05 (Premium Package) aud would become approx $55.25 aud. When I did a further dummy booking the total quoted was $1519.18 for two people. This made the amount charged $69.05 per person per day (11). So - under normal circumstances with no discount a Premium Package would be approx $82.85 aud !!! Also, on the 11th day - disembarkation day - I'm sure no-one will drink very much at all !!

     

    Mmmmm at this stage very much leaning towards NO drink package !!

    I found this link online for drink menus, for non Australian cruises.

     

    http://www.cruisewithgambee.com/royal-caribbean-drink/

     

    So I would recommend adding $1-$2 on top of this menu price, to give you an idea of what the menus will be for Australian cruises, as Australian drink menus include gratuities.

     

    Etc roughly a $12US drink is $14US. Roughly only to give you an idea.

     

    Work out how much you would spend on drinks for your cruise, in US dollars, adding approx $1-$2 on top of each drink price. Then convert this amount to AUD.

     

    Now compare this amount of how much you'd spend on drinks, to the cost of the package.

     

    The drink packages are currently discounted when you log in to your cruise personaliser. The price here is in AUD and there is no extra tipping on top of the drink package price.

  10. 18% is added at checkout for gratuities.

     

    There has been difference in 'discount' lately. If the Select is approx $42 aud and Premium approx $52 aud - then these are discounted and you should buy now (they are not usually discounted on board).

     

    I think at the moment, for wines by the glass the Select package limit is $9 usd, and Premium/Ultimate package limit is $12 usd. If you ordered a more expensive glass you pay the couple of dollars difference.

    Regarding the Martini Bar, Classic Package holders CAN order the following MARTINIS only:

    Classic Martini, Cosmopolitan, Gin Martini, Peach Martini. All of them will be served in small martini glasses, which are big enough for me.

    All other cocktails, beers, wines, sodas, spirits and liquors covered by the classic package can be ordered without problem there.

    We were also on that cruise. We were surprised (shocked) at the prices of alcohol compared to our last Solstice cruise two and a half years ago. We usually enjoyed a bottle of wine with each dinner, however, this time with the cheapest bottle being over $40, we did not. Looking around Blu many people shared this opinion - the majority of tables were without wine. The drink packages were heavily pushed the first couple of days - we don't drink enough to make these economically viable. Cocktails were also far more expensive than before.
